While we don't have a huge Klingon community in Ubuntu (at least not according to the Klingon Translations Team[1]), it would still be nice to at least be able to display the Wikipedia Klingon Language page[2] properly without having the subtitle display as blocks. Also, it would be a nice exercise for the font designers and having at least some support for an obscure constructed language does allow some bragging rights. Having just a few glyphs initially would maybe inspire some Klingon speakers to get involved and develop some more glyphs.
